Undergraduate/Graduate Credit
CTE Conference participants are able to register for one credit, offered at both the undergraduate and graduate levels. Individuals wanting to earn credit will need to attend the entire conference and complete an assignment following the conclusion of the conference. The Big Reveal: Get a first glance at the Perkins V CTE- Local Needs Assessment Framework!

The CTE- Local Needs Assessment will provide an opportunity to evaluate strengths and opportunities in your local CTE program. Session topics will include:
  • Key Components
  • Timeframes and Planning for Success
  • First Steps for Getting Started
  • Provide interactive feedback related to the proposed framework.
